In a remarkable display of police persistence, a murder suspect who had been evading capture for nearly four decades has finally been apprehended in Uttar Pradesh's Moradabad district. The arrest brings closure to a case that had remained open for 38 years, demonstrating that justice may be delayed but not denied.
The Long-Awaited Capture
Babu Khan, now 58 years old, was arrested by the Uttar Pradesh Police after spending most of his adult life as a fugitive. The dramatic arrest occurred in the Mundapandey area of Moradabad, where Khan had been living under the radar. The case dates back to April 10, 1986, when Khan was allegedly involved in a violent altercation that resulted in the death of another individual.
According to police records, the incident began as a heated argument between Babu Khan and the victim. The confrontation quickly escalated into physical violence, culminating in Khan allegedly attacking the victim with a sharp weapon. The victim sustained critical injuries and succumbed to them shortly after the assault.
Decades of Evasion and Police Pursuit
For 38 years, Babu Khan successfully avoided law enforcement, moving between locations and likely changing his appearance and identity multiple times. The case had grown cold over the years, but Uttar Pradesh Police never officially closed the investigation. The breakthrough came when current police personnel decided to revisit older unsolved cases and apply modern investigative techniques.
Senior Superintendent of Police (SSP) of Moradabad, Shyam Prasad, confirmed the details of the arrest. The Mundapandey police station team executed the operation that led to Khan's capture. Police officials noted that the accused had become complacent over the years, likely believing that the authorities had forgotten about his case.
The arrest required careful planning and surveillance. Officers had to confirm the identity of the suspect, which proved challenging given the passage of time and potential changes in the man's appearance. Once positive identification was established, the police moved swiftly to make the arrest.
Legal Proceedings and Future Steps
Following his arrest, Babu Khan has been presented before the local court and remanded to judicial custody. The legal process will now move forward, with prosecutors preparing to present evidence from the original case alongside new findings.
